Can A Police Officer Afford Rent in Fernley, NV?

Stretched but workable — rent takes 30.3% of gross income.

Fernley rent: June 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Nevada state estimate).

Fernley median rent
$1,891/mo
Police Officer salary (Nevada)
$74,952/yr
Rent as % of income
30.3%
Gross monthly income works out to about $6,246, and the 30% rule supports up to $1,874/mo in rent. Fernley's median rent of $1,891 exceeds that threshold by $17/mo, putting a police officer salary into the rent-burdened range here. A police officer works roughly 52.5 hours a month to cover that rent.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Nevada state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Fernley, NV.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
